Category | Details |
---|---|
Full Name | Eric Lynn Wright |
Also Known As | Eazy-E |
Born | September 7, 1964 |
Died | March 26, 1995 |
Place of Birth | Compton, California, USA |
Occupation | Rapper, Songwriter, Entrepreneur, Record Producer |
Key Contributions | Co-founder of N.W.A, Founder of Ruthless Records, Pioneer of Gangsta Rap |
Net Worth (at Death) | Estimated $8 million |
Peak Net Worth (Estimated) | $35 million |
Estimated Net Worth (2025) | $50 million |
Primary Source of Income | Music Sales, Ruthless Records, Royalties |
Notable Albums/Songs | "Eazy-Duz-It," "Impact of a Legend," N.W.A albums |
Legacy | Pioneer of gangsta rap, influential figure in hip-hop, entrepreneur |

The hip-hop world lost a giant when Eric Lynn Wright, famously known as Eazy-E, passed away in 1995. While the outpouring of grief and tributes highlighted his impact on the world of music, the financial aspect of his life was also subject to great interest. In the aftermath of his death, figuring out the value of his estate became a complex task, given that it involved his assets, business dealings, and the ongoing revenue streams from his music and label.
At the time of his death, multiple sources cited an estimated net worth of around $8 million. However, other reports suggest that his wealth had peaked much higher, reaching approximately $35 million at the height of N.W.As success. This substantial difference speaks to the challenges of valuing the assets of a high-profile individual whose wealth was tied to various income sources like music royalties, business ownership, and investments. The actual figure has long been debated. Factors like the fluctuating nature of royalties, the valuation of Ruthless Records, and other investment ventures add layers of intricacy to the calculation. The formation of N.W.A in the mid-1980s marked a pivotal moment in hip-hop history. The group, comprised of Eazy-E, Ice Cube, Dr. Dre, MC Ren, and DJ Yella, pioneered the gangsta rap subgenre, which brought raw, unfiltered portrayals of street life to the forefront of popular culture. Eazy-E's role as both a central member of the group and as the founder of Ruthless Records was crucial to N.W.A's success. His entrepreneurial vision and business sense set him apart from his peers, as he took the initiative to start a label that would sign and nurture his fellow artists. Eazy-E's influence as the face of the group and his ownership of Ruthless Records were pivotal in generating massive revenue for the group. Hits like "Straight Outta Compton" and "Fuck tha Police" became anthems, driving album sales and concert revenues, and therefore, contributing significantly to the financial prosperity of the group members.
The financial impact of N.W.A extended beyond album sales and live performances. The group's controversial and often provocative lyrics made it a subject of controversy, leading to media attention and increasing its popularity. Eazy-Es ownership of Ruthless Records was another key element of his financial strategy. The label not only released N.W.A's music, but it also signed and promoted other successful artists, generating additional income streams. This savvy business move enhanced Eazy-E's overall net worth. Beyond the group, Eazy-E released his solo album "Eazy-Duz-It" in 1988, which sold millions of copies, further boosting his financial standing. The album's success underscored his ability to connect with the audience as a solo artist, adding to the overall profitability of his music career. His career was not just about music; it was about building an enterprise.
The economic legacy of Eazy-E is intricately linked to the success of Ruthless Records. The record label was more than just a business venture; it was a platform. It released N.W.A's groundbreaking music and launched the careers of numerous other artists, including Bone Thugs-n-Harmony and The D.O.C. This made Ruthless Records a significant source of income, with profits generated through record sales, royalties, and licensing agreements. The fact that the label continued to generate income long after Eazy-E's death is proof of the enduring value of his vision and his strategic investments. The success of Ruthless Records also served as a testament to Eazy-E's business acumen, which extended beyond his creative talents. It was his smart management and his foresight that built a record label with a roster of talent that defined a generation.
The financial trajectory of Eazy-E after his death presents an interesting case study in legacy management and the music industry. While the immediate aftermath of his passing involved the assessment of his assets and the distribution of his estate, the continuous income streams from his music and label ensured his legacy continued to generate value. Ruthless Records continued to function, generating royalties from its extensive catalog of music. His family, particularly his wife Tomica Woods-Wright, inherited his estate, becoming responsible for managing his business affairs. This included overseeing the label, licensing his music, and ensuring that royalties were properly collected and distributed. The management of his intellectual property rights and his music was crucial in preserving his financial legacy.
